Output 25573a16b08d92db246358a731b4250f2a36daa23e01ed7a527c5584115caacf:20

value
172897
script pubkey
OP_0 OP_PUSHBYTES_20 50ae2c5284d32f0d7766620aa0aff2f3d41f29ff
address
bc1q2zhzc55y6vhs6amxvg92ptlj702p720l0xv6xg
transaction
25573a16b08d92db246358a731b4250f2a36daa23e01ed7a527c5584115caacf